FC Samartex 1996 recorded their sixth victory of the 2022/23 Ghana Premier League season after thrashing Real Tamale United on Sunday afternoon.
The Timber Giants exercised their attacking muscles to register three goals against Real Tamale United in their match-week 18 fixture at the Nsenkyire Park in Samreboi.
Coach Annor Walker returned to the dug-out of FC Samartex 1996 for the first time after a month duties at Black Galaxies camp for the just-ended CHAN tournament in Algeria.
He handed starting berth to Evans Osei-Wusu, who joined the club earlier this week after ending his stay at Division One League side Tema Youth SC.
Midfield dynamo Emmanuel Keyekeh scored in both halves for FC Samartex after capitalizing on the defensive errors of Real Tamale United.
Newly-signed attacker Isaac Opoku Agyemang climbed off the bench to complete the 3-0 win of FC Samartex with his strike on the 95th minute of the game.
Following the result, FC Samartex 1996 have moved up on the Ghana Premier League to 9th position with 26 points while Real Tamale United occupies 11th position with 24 position after match-day 18.
